Taipei, Aug. 31 (CNA) The person who becomes the 500 millionth renter of Taiwan's public bicycle-rental system, YouBike, in Taipei in the coming weeks will receive a shopping voucher for NT$20,000 (US$630), the Taipei City Department of Transportation said Monday.
In a press release on the program's high number of riders, the department projected that the 500 millionth YouBike renter milestone would be hit around Sept. 14.
The projection is based on the department's statistics, which show that Taipei's bike-rental system hit its 100 millionth user mark in April 2018.
It then took about three and a half years to hit the 200 millionth mark, before surpassing the 300 millionth milestone approximately two and a half years after that.
With the relaunch of the first-30-minutes-free policy under Taipei Mayor Chiang Wan-an (蔣萬安) on Feb. 28, 2024, it then took just 17 months for the system to accumulate another 100 million users to hit 400 million.
The city department said the person identified as the 500 millionth YouBike user to rent a bike from a station in Taipei and return it within the capital will receive NT$20,000 in shopping credits, redeemable for vouchers at any of its 16 commercial partners.
Additionally, the five cyclists who rent a bike in Taipei immediately before and the five who rent one immediately after the 500 millionth user will each receive NT$1,000 in shopping vouchers for use at Taiwan lifestyle and beauty retail chain Poya.
The department added that the 11 winners will be announced on its official website and also the Taipei YouBike Facebook fan page, while the winners themselves will be notified via text messages and phone calls.
According to the department's statistics, there are 1,794 YouBike stations around Taipei at present, averaging 150-200 meters between each other.
Taipei is home to 27,438 YouBike bicycles, of which 4,350 are electric models that help riders accelerate.
YouBikes in Kaohsiung
Echoing Taipei's efforts to help the city go green by supporting commuting with YouBikes, the Kaohsiung City Transportation Bureau on Monday also announced that it will be adding 1,200 more bicycles to the city's YouBike system.
The bureau said it has planned to add 965 bicycles and 235 electric bikes by November this year, bringing the total number of YouBike bicycles in the southern Taiwan port city to 14,306 units, 2,141 of which would be electric.
Since incorporating the YouBike 2.0 system into the city in 2020, Kaohsiung now has 1,500 stations, and its system has accumulated about 91 million users, the bureau said.
